The Nature Around Me. Tuesday, 16 June 2015. I was fairly sure this was a juvenile blackbird as I thought I could already start to make out the yellow beak and eye ring forming. It's main feathers have mostly developed, with just a few tufts of his chick feathers remaining. But after several discussions on various sites and more investigation it appears to be a juvenile Starling that must have only just fledged. Starlings are resident all year in the UK. The Nature Around Me. Tuesday, 16 June 2015. The Guelder Rose also known as Water Elder, Cramp Bark, Snowball Tree and Eropean Cranberry Bush, Viburnum opulus, flowers are now starting to open up. This shrub is native to Europe and is often planted in the UK as an ornamental. The leaves have three lobes and resemble the Mapel. Subscribe to: Post Comments (Atom). View my complete profile. The Nature Around Me. Tuesday, 16 June 2015. There were a lot of quite large clumps of Common Comfrey growing along the banks of The River Snail in Fordham, Cambridgeshire. It is also known as True Comfrey, Quaker Comfrey, Cultivated Comfrey, Boneset, Knitbone, Consound and Slippery Root. It is native to Europe and the flowers are either whiteish cream or blue, I saw both along this stretch of river. Subscribe to: Post Comments (Atom). View my complete profile. Web Sites I Follow. Turkey Through My Camera Lens. Saturday, 1 March 2014. Fishing Off Paradise Beach. Our local beach cafe offers 'locally caught' fish on its menu, and when they say 'locally caught', they mean caught right off their stretch of beach. As well as using fishing rods they use a smaller version of the drag net type of fishing, where they cast out a net in a half circle off the beach using a small fishing boat. The fish had obviously decided to go to a different spot, as today's catch was one fish and an octopus.

The Nature and Value of Faith project is a three-year initiative based at Baylor University, co-directed by Trent Dougherty. Our project examines the nature of faith as a psychological attitude, state, or orientation in order to understand its value, its proper evaluation, and its contribution to a well-lived life.
